What You'll Do

  • Driving a positive and proactive Health & Safety culture across the venue
  • Providing professional HSEQ and Food Safety guidance to operational teams
  • Conducting audits, inspections and compliance reviews across kitchens, hospitality suites and concessions
  • Investigating accidents, incidents and near misses, identifying root causes and implementing preventative actions
  • Delivering engaging training, toolbox talks and inductions to managers and frontline teams
  • Supporting major event planning and ensuring safe operational delivery on matchdays and event days
  • Developing and maintaining risk assessments, RAMS, COSHH assessments and safe systems of work
  • Supporting food safety compliance and assisting with environmental health inspections
  • Producing insightful reports and KPI analysis to drive performance improvements
  • Building strong relationships with Newcastle United and key stakeholders to ensure seamless compliance across the venue

What You Bring

Essential

  • NEBOSH qualification (or working towards within an agreed timeframe)
  • Experience within a Health & Safety, HSEQ or Food Safety position
  • Strong knowledge of Health & Safety legislation and compliance frameworks
  • Experience managing audits, inspections and compliance systems
  • Experience investigating accidents and incidents
  • Excellent communication and relationship-building skills
  • Ability to analyse data and identify trends and improvement opportunities
  • Strong organisational skills with the ability to prioritise effectively
  • Good working knowledge of Microsoft Office, including Excel, Word and PowerPoint
  • Level 4 Food Safety qualification, or willingness to achieve within six months

Desirable

  • Experience within stadiums, events, hospitality, catering or visitor attractions
  • IOSH, CIEH or other professional membership
  • Auditing qualifications or experience
  • First Aid qualification
  • Experience working within ISO accredited environments
  • Demonstrable success in delivering continuous improvement initiatives
